Bachelor Of Pharmacy (B.Pharmacy) Admission Process

The Bachelor of Pharmacy (B.Pharmacy) is a 4-year degree course with 8 semesters in which the candidates learn about maintaining a standardised quality of people’s health and living. The program teaches the candidates how to become attentive professionals so as to ensure the selection of the right drug for the right treatment.

Bachelor of Pharmacy (B.Pharmacy) Eligibility Criteria

The eligibility criteria for the Bachelor of Pharmacy (B.Pharmacy) are as follows:-

  • The candidates must have qualified their 12th board examination with Physics, Chemistry, and Biology (PCB).
  • The students should have cleared their 12th from a recognised board.
  • The applicants must have secured a minimum of 50% in their 12th.
  • The candidates should not have any physical disability.
  • The students should not have any colour blindness.

What does one learn after taking admission in Bachelor of Pharmacy (B.Pharmacy)?

Some of the subjects in this course are written below:-

  • Human Anatomy and Physiology-1
  • Pharmaceutical Analysis-1
  • Pharmaceutical Inorganic Chemistry
  • Pharmaceutics-1
  • Communication skills
  • Remedial Biology
  • Human Anatomy and Physiology-2
  • Pharmaceutical Organic Chemistry-1
  • Biochemistry
  • Pathophysiology
  • Computer Applications in Pharmacy
  • Environmental sciences
  • Pharmaceutical Organic Chemistry-2
  • And many more

Why take admission in Bachelor of Pharmacy (B.Pharmacy)?

Pharmacy is one of the courses with the scope for advanced learning and a wide spectrum of opportunities in terms of its complex terminologies, wide perception building attitude, and basics techniques. The field of pharmaceuticals related to this is also being considered as a big opportunity at this time. People interested in searching or developing useful medicines that can benefit in various diseases can make a career in this sector by taking various courses related to the Pharmacy Sector.
